当调试故障时,此方案是必选工具。若已有 3 次以上的修复尝试均告失败,此方案更是不可或缺。在实施修复前,必须深入探究根本原因,确保问题得到彻底解决。
Bug 修复工作流。从症状入手,循序渐进地定位并解决问题。当您需要修复 Bug、排查疑难问题,或处理错误报告时,可使用此技能。
精通外部 API 集成、后端代理架构、后端函数、速率限制,以及数据获取策略。当您需要与外部服务集成、设计后端函数,或了解数据如何从外部源流向数据库时,可使用此技能。参考 docs/06_integration_spec.md。
以端口与适配器(六边形架构)的视角,对整个代码库进行全面架构审视。评估边界违规、耦合问题以及依赖方向,从而制定优先级分明的改进路线图。当您需要从可测试性与可移植性角度审视架构、评估技术债务、规划重构工作,或评估代码库健康状况时,可使用此技能。当用户提出“审视架构”“评估耦合”“六边形分析”“检查边界违规”或“架构点评”等需求时,此技能便会自动触发。
通用指南,适用于捕捉、分析并验证任意语言或框架下的 TUI(终端用户界面)截图。当您需要构建、测试或重构 TUI,尤其在需要对颜色、布局、间距以及交互状态进行视觉验证时,可使用此技能。
Yellow Network SDK集成与开发指南,用于基于Nitrolite状态通道协议、ClearNodes以及@erc7824/nitrolite SDK构建dApp。在以下场景中使用此功能:(1) Yellow Network集成——状态通道、ClearNodes、Nitrolite协议、ERC-7824;(2) @erc7824/nitrolite NPM包——NitroliteRPC、NitroliteClient;(3) 与clearnet.yellow.com的WebSocket连接;(4) 通道管理——创建、关闭、调整大小、发起挑战、进行检查点;(5) 链下转账与统一余额;(6) 多方参与的状态通道,配备加权法定人数;(7) 用于委托签名的会话密钥;(8) 通过ClearNodes实现EIP-712认证;(9) $YELLOW代币经济与质押机制;(10) Yellow Network架构相关问题,或通过ClearNodes实现跨链/链抽象。
按照 Keep a Changelog 格式,以日期为基准进行版本管理,维护 CHANGELOG.md 文件。当对面向用户或面向贡献者的变更进行调整时,使用此方法判断是否需要更新 CHANGELOG。
大脑状态
利用 Octave 库,将现有内容(文本、文件、URL)重新定向至不同受众、目标角色或应用场景
根据你的库中 ICP 标准,寻找、丰富并筛选潜在客户
分析已成交与未成交的交易,提炼模式、洞见与经验教训
存储并检索项目知识——决策、经验、成果、陷阱。提供短暂思考的文档,用于深思熟虑。适用于记录决策、搜索过往知识、检查陷阱、链接记忆、保存模式。触发词——记住、存储、保存、记录、决策、学习、陷阱、成果、模式、搜索记忆、检查陷阱、头脑风暴、深思熟虑、利弊权衡。注意——相较于顺序思维的 MCP,更倾向于记忆思维,因为思绪会持续留存,并可被转化为永久记忆。